MEE has been hired by the National
Campaign to Prevent Teen and Unplanned Pregnancy (NCPTP)
to develop a social media campaign designed to educate
and raise the awareness of young African American and
Hispanic women regarding long-acting, reversible contraceptive
(LARC) options. One of the primary features of the social
media campaign will be a series of video clips featuring
women of color, ages 18-25 years-old, talking about their
experiences with various types of birth control.
MEE will develop a video channel through YouTube and a "fan" page on Facebook that will serve as clearinghouses for culturally-relevant video, audio and textual content related to LARCs while also providing a gateway to the NCPTP Website, www.BedSider.org.
